Official: Liverpool Recall Winger From Loan Spell With German Club
Published: January 08, 2018
Through a statement on their official website, Premier League side Liverpool have confirmed that promising winger Ryan Kent has been recalled from his loan spell with German outfit Freiburg.
The former England U20 international had been expected to spend the entirety of this season at the Bundesliga club but has returned to his parent club due to his lack of first-team opportunities.
Kent tasted action for only 241 minutes from a possible 1,530 in all competitions for Freiburg.
The 21-year-old penned a multi-year contract with Liverpool before he was farmed out on loan to garner first-team experience.
He made his first-team debut for the Reds in an FA Cup third-round tie with Exeter City in January 2016.
The winger joined Liverpool at the age of seven.
